Currently, on Linux, if I want to steer off from my system's default "libstdc++" and specify a different standard library implementation (often a must when using a compiler that isn't GCC to prevent compilation errors due to the compiler not being able to compile with libstdc++) I must do the following:
buildoptions "-stdlib=libc++"
linkoptions "-stdlib=libc++"
Because in my actual project I will be using clang, this will tell the compiler and linker to use the std library from the llvm-project itself which will have optimal compatibility with the compiler. I found there are no shorter or other premake settings for achieving a similar result so it must be done manually via buildoptions and linkoptions
